Sanshou Fighting Workshop
Even if a student doesn’t want to become a fighter, it’s good for them to have their skills tested in the ring. This is why fighting is such a good test of our martial skill. It is not just about how well we are doing in our physical training but also how our mind is doing. Is it at calm or is it panicking? How do we control it? If we’re not in control then how can we control our opponent? It’s vitally important that we don’t allow ourselves to be thrown by our opponent both mentally and physically for this can cost us the fight. Fighting shows us in a very direct way how we deal with pressure. It shows us how quick our reflexes are and if we’ve been doing enough stamina training.
